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0847 5065894 45666 46921
15881542 1073243
15881542 1073243
063125924 739829 71 84359 869753
All about undefined
Interested in learning more?
15881542 1073243
063125924 739829 71 84359 869753
See more
3295288280 5967
072868 889 2626996692
See more
637669 4080 9066
32548418250 8951 67630
See more